Acoustic panels do not make your speakers louder. They help your speakers sound clearer by controlling unwanted sound reflections inside your home theater. Proper acoustic treatment can improve dialogue clarity, surround sound imaging, musical detail, and overall listening comfort.

Sound from your speakers travels directly toward the seating area, but it also travels toward the walls, ceiling, floor, doors, and other surfaces in the room. Hard surfaces reflect that sound back toward the listener.
These reflections arrive slightly after the original sound from the speakers. When direct sound and reflected sound overlap, dialogue can become harder to understand, music can lose detail, and surround effects can sound less precise.
Acoustic panels absorb a portion of this reflected sound energy before it bounces back into the room. This allows you to hear more of the original soundtrack and less interference from the room itself.
The goal of acoustic treatment is not to eliminate every reflection. The goal is to control excessive reflections so the room sounds clear, balanced, and natural.
Dialogue clarity is one of the most noticeable benefits of proper acoustic treatment. Voices are usually reproduced by the center channel speaker, but sound from that speaker can reflect off nearby walls, the ceiling, and the floor.
When those reflections reach the seating position, they can overlap with the direct dialogue and make words sound muddy or indistinct. This is especially noticeable during action scenes, when music and sound effects compete with spoken dialogue.
Acoustic panels placed at important reflection points help reduce this interference. Voices become cleaner and easier to understand without constantly increasing the center channel volume.
A properly calibrated home theater should make sounds appear to come from specific locations around the room. Reflections can blur those locations and make the soundstage feel less precise.

Instead of hearing a general wash of sound, you can hear individual effects and channels more clearly.
Rooms with drywall, glass, tile, hardwood, or other hard surfaces can produce noticeable echo and reverberation. This is sometimes described as a live, hollow, or ringing sound.
Acoustic panels reduce the amount of sound energy that continues bouncing around the room after the original sound has stopped. This can make the theater feel quieter and more controlled, even before the movie begins.
The improvement is often noticeable in normal conversation. Voices sound less harsh, and the room becomes more comfortable for extended listening.
Excessive reflections can make a home theater sound bright, harsh, or fatiguing. You may find yourself lowering the volume during loud scenes even though quieter dialogue is still difficult to hear.
By controlling reflections, acoustic panels can create a smoother and more balanced listening environment. This makes it easier to enjoy movies, sports, television, and music for longer periods without listening fatigue.
Acoustic treatment and soundproofing solve two different problems.
Improves the sound inside the room by reducing echoes and controlling reflections.
Reduces sound transmission between the theater and the rest of the building.
Acoustic panels alone will not stop deep bass or loud movie soundtracks from traveling through walls, ceilings, floors, doors, or ductwork.

Acoustic panels are most effective when they are placed where strong reflections occur. Important treatment areas commonly include:
You do not need to cover every wall. A well-planned layout targets the most important reflection areas while preserving a natural amount of room ambience.

Standard wall panels primarily control midrange and higher-frequency reflections. Low-frequency problems may require thicker absorbers, bass traps, multiple subwoofers, careful placement, and electronic room correction.
Yes. Excessive absorption can make a room sound unnaturally dull. The best approach is to treat key reflection points and use an appropriate percentage of available wall area.
